New York City Mayor-elect Zohran Mamdani has endorsed Diana Moreno in the upcoming special election to fill his current seat in the New York State Assembly. The endorsement came Saturday, as Moreno campaigns to succeed Mamdani in the Assembly.
Mamdani’s Support for Moreno
Mamdani stated, “I can’t imagine anyone more capable of carrying our movement forward than Diana, who has fought tirelessly for union workers, immigrant communities, and our neighbors across this district. Diana has my full support.” Both Mamdani and Moreno identify as democratic socialists.
Moreno’s campaign, as outlined in a social media post, focuses on continuing Mamdani’s “affordability agenda” and addressing what she describes as a “rising tide of fascism.”
The Road Ahead
Moreno is currently competing against three other candidates: Mary Jobaida, Rana Abdelhamid, and Shivani Dhir. A special election is anticipated on February 3rd to determine who will fill the Assembly seat.
